Image description:
|
Its famous forecourt (cour d'honneur), is screened with columns and, since 1986, contains Daniel Buren's site-specific artpiece, Les Deux Plateaux, known as Les Colonnes de Buren; a monumental composition of 280 black and white columns of unequal height.
